Introduction

Global Meal Replacement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031

In the year 2024, the Global Meal Replacement Market was valued at USD 13,944.63 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 20,284.97 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.5%.

The global meal replacement market has witnessed significant growth and transformation as consumer lifestyles and dietary preferences evolve worldwide. Meal replacements are nutritional products designed to replace one or more regular meals, offering convenience, portion control, and balanced nutrition in a convenient format. These products range from shakes and bars to powders and ready-to-drink beverages, catering to a broad spectrum of consumer needs, from weight management to nutritional supplementation.

Key drivers of the global meal replacement market include the increasing prevalence of busy lifestyles, where consumers seek quick and nutritious meal options that fit seamlessly into their daily routines. As urbanization and hectic schedules become more prevalent, meal replacements provide a practical solution for individuals looking to maintain a balanced diet without sacrificing nutrition or taste. Moreover, rising health consciousness and awareness of the importance of a balanced diet have fueled demand for meal replacements that offer specific nutritional benefits, such as protein-rich or low-calorie options.

Technological advancements and innovations in food processing have also played a pivotal role in shaping the market landscape. Improved formulation techniques, better taste profiles, and enhanced shelf stability have contributed to the popularity and acceptance of meal replacements among consumers. Additionally, the COVID-19 pandemic further accelerated market growth, with lockdowns and social distancing measures prompting increased interest in meal replacements as a convenient and safe alternative to traditional meal preparation and dining out.

The market faces challenges and restraints, including regulatory scrutiny regarding the nutritional content and health claims of meal replacement products. Consumer skepticism and preference for whole foods over processed alternatives also pose challenges to market expansion. Nevertheless, the opportunities are vast, with the potential for market players to innovate further in terms of taste, nutritional profile, and sustainability. The global meal replacement market is poised for continued growth as companies adapt to changing consumer demands and preferences, leveraging technological advancements to enhance product offerings and expand market reach.
